Ingredients You’ll Need
To make this recipe, you only need a handful of simple ingredients:
- Pasta such as spaghetti, linguine, or penne
- Canned tuna (in olive oil or water)
- Capers, rinsed to reduce excess salt
- Olive oil
- Garlic
- Chili flakes (optional)
- Salt and black pepper
- Fresh parsley or lemon zest for garnish
These pantry staples make Pasta with Tuna and Capers an ideal last-minute meal when you don’t want to run to the store.
Step-by-Step Cooking Instructions
- Cook the pasta in well-salted boiling water until al dente. Reserve some pasta water before draining.
- Heat olive oil in a pan over medium heat and gently sauté the garlic until fragrant.
- Add the tuna, breaking it into chunks, then stir in the capers.
- Toss the drained pasta into the pan and add a splash of reserved pasta water to loosen the sauce.
- Season with black pepper and chili flakes if using, then mix well and remove from heat.
Flavor Tips and Variations
You can easily customize Pasta with Tuna and Capers to suit your taste. Add olives for extra Mediterranean flavor, cherry tomatoes for freshness, or a squeeze of lemon juice to brighten the dish. For a richer version, finish with a small knob of butter or a sprinkle of grated Parmesan.
Health Benefits of This Dish
This recipe is not only delicious but also nutritious. Tuna provides lean protein and omega-3 fatty acids, while olive oil offers heart-healthy fats. Capers are low in calories and add intense flavor without the need for heavy sauces, making this dish a lighter pasta option.
Serving and Storage Suggestions
Serve Pasta with Tuna and Capers immediately for the best taste and texture. Pair it with a simple green salad or crusty bread for a complete meal.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to two days and reheated gently on the stove.
